Key Features to Look For

Finding the right projector means knowing what matters. Here are some key features:

  • Resolution: This tells you how clear the picture will be.
    • Native Resolution: This is the projector’s real resolution. Look for at least 720p (1280 x 720 pixels) for a clear picture. Some projectors offer 1080p (1920 x 1080 pixels).
  • Brightness (Lumens): This shows how bright the image is.
    • ANSI Lumens: This is the standard measurement. For a dim room, 1000-2000 lumens might work. For brighter rooms, you will need more.
  • Contrast Ratio: This is the difference between the darkest and brightest colors.
    • A higher ratio means better picture quality. Look for at least 1000:1.
  • Connectivity: How will you connect your devices?
    • HDMI: This is needed for most modern devices.
    • USB: This is useful for playing media from a flash drive.
    • Wi-Fi/Bluetooth: These let you connect wirelessly.
  • Throw Ratio: This tells you how far the projector needs to be from the screen.
    • Short Throw: These projectors can make a big picture from a short distance.
    • Long Throw: These need more space.
  • Keystone Correction: This corrects the picture if the projector isn’t straight on.
    • It can make the image square if the projector is tilted.

Factors That Improve or Reduce Quality

Several things can change the picture quality. Keep these in mind:

  • Room Lighting: A dark room is best. Even a bright room can wash out the image.
  • Screen Quality: A good screen helps the picture look better. A white wall can work, too.
  • Speaker Quality: Most budget projectors have built-in speakers. They are often not very good. Consider using external speakers.
  • Fan Noise: Some projectors can be loud. Read reviews to see if the fan noise bothers people.
  • Image Size: Bigger isn’t always better. The image size depends on your room and the projector’s throw ratio.
